Notice on the Decisions Regarding Rules Violation

  Parties concerned:
  Zhang Min, born in 1988, Chenzhou, Hunan
  Chen Ying,born in 1978, Huangpu District, Shanghai
  Tang Mingjun, born in 1997, Chenzhou, Hunan.
  On July 3, 2020, via operating the futures account of Tang Mingjun, Zhang Min conducted accommodation trading with Chen Ying on crude oil (SC) 2303 contract at a pre-agreed price, which resulted in profit gains for the futures account of Tang Mingjun and losses to Chen Ying’s account, affecting the price of futures trading.
  The above-mentioned behavior has violated the provision in Article 29, paragraph 1, section 3 of the Enforcement Rules of the Shanghai International Energy Exchange, which stipulates the conduct of "applying methods such as transferring or splitting positions between accounts, or accommodation trade, to affect the prices on the Exchange, or to transfer funds between accounts or make illegal profits” as constituting rule violation relating to trading management.
  Accordingly, Shanghai International Energy Exchange (INE) decides to give a warning to Tang Mingjun and Chen Ying, and a reprimand to Zhang Min and require him to make rectifications, suspend the accounts of Zhang Min and Tang Mingjun from opening positions and trading for 3 months, and suspend the account of Chen Ying from opening positions and trading for 1 month.
  Relevant futures firms shall strengthen client compliance, improve the monitoring and management of online transactions, and prevent the recurrence of similar incidents. INE will record the relevant decisions of rule violation into the Securities and Futures Market Credibility File Database.
